Let’s be honest: virtual reality in education sounds like the coolest thing since sliced bread. The idea of students stepping into VR classrooms, exploring VR biology labs, or traveling across the solar system in VR physics is undeniably appealing. But is VR truly the all-encompassing cure that will magically fix disengaged students, outdated teaching methods, and complex STEM topics? Let’s take a closer look, referencing real examples of VR learning that bring this debate to life—and see where VR is brilliant and where it might fall short.

Conclusion: A Powerful Tool, Not a Cure-All
“VR education is awesome,” you say. “Why aren’t all schools using it?” The simple answer is that while VR offers incredible advantages—like interactive classroom activities, improved STEM lab experiences, and digital classroom innovations—it’s not the only path forward.
Still, the possibilities are thrilling. Through carefully designed VR lessons, students can explore everything from the internal structure of cells to electrification in physics, from bullying interventions to emergency responses. Used thoughtfully, VR can transform how we learn and teach.
Just remember: no single technology instantly solves all educational dilemmas. By blending virtual reality in education with strong pedagogy, relevant curricula, and ongoing teacher support, we stand a better chance of giving kids the rich, future-focused learning experiences they deserve.
